演示恢复和备份
create database tt;
use tt;
create table a
(
name varchar(20)
);
insert into a(name) values('aaaa');
select * from a;
-----看到a表有数据
对tt作备份操作,启动一个window命令行窗口,执行如下命令
mysqldump -uroot -p tt>c:\tt.sql
演示恢复
1.先删除库
drop database tt;
2.恢复tt库(1)
2.1 为恢复库,要先创建库 create database tt;
2.2 再恢复tt库
use tt;
source c:\tt.sql (source:可以执行一个 sql脚本)
3.恢复tt库(2)
2.1 为恢复库,要先创建库 create database tt;
2.2 恢复库 mysql -uroot -proot tt<c:\1.sql; (window命令)
create database tt;
use tt;
create table a
(
name varchar(20)
);
insert into a(name) values('aaaa');
select * from a;
-----看到a表有数据
对tt作备份操作,启动一个window命令行窗口,执行如下命令
mysqldump -uroot -p tt>c:\tt.sql
演示恢复
1.先删除库
drop database tt;
2.恢复tt库(1)
2.1 为恢复库,要先创建库 create database tt;
2.2 再恢复tt库
use tt;
source c:\tt.sql (source:可以执行一个 sql脚本)
3.恢复tt库(2)
2.1 为恢复库,要先创建库 create database tt;
2.2 恢复库 mysql -uroot -proot tt<c:\1.sql; (window命令)